Rashists are preparing forced mobilization in the occupied Zaporozhye – CNS

    The occupation administration in the temporarily occupied territories of the Zaporozhye region is preparing for the forced mobilization of local residents into the ranks of the enemy army.

    This was announced today, July 1, on the website of the Center for National Resistance.

    Thus, the occupiers have created 44 “military registration desks”, in which all citizens of military age or military personnel of the reserve will be registered at the place of residence, the report says.

    It is noted that the collaborator Yevgeny Balitsky, who was appointed the “governor” of the Zaporozhye region by the Reshists, is trying to mislead the population and disseminates frankly manipulative data on the “effective work of the occupation administration on the official registration and development of the people’s militia of Zaporozhye.”

    In fact, we have another crime of occupiers in the region, because international law prohibits the recruitment or mobilization of the population of the occupied territories, the CNS notes.

    Recall that in May, the CNS reported that in the occupied territories of Zaporizhzhya, Russian rashists arrested men in order to put pressure on them later in order to mobilize them into the ranks of the occupying troops.
